Manual Focus
You might need to focus manually under
certain conditions.
1. Set the POWER switch to CAMERA
MAN.
2. Rotate the zoom lever to T to zoom in
on the subject and center the subject
in the viewfinder.
3. Press the menu PUSH dial in to
display the menu in the viewfinder.
FOCUS is highlighted.

4. Press the menu PUSH dial in to
display the FOCUS menu.
AUTO
MANU
EXIT
FOCUS
5. Rotate the menu PUSH dial to
highlight MANU and press the dial in.
appears in the viewfinder.
The focus is locked at this point.
6. Adjust the focus for a subject nearer
or farther away.
Rotate the menu PUSH dial up to
focus on a subject farther away.

Rotate the menu PUSH dial down
to focus on a subject nearer.

7. Press the menu PUSH dial twice to
remove the menus.
Note: To return to auto focus, select
AUTO in the FOCUS menu or set the
POWER switch to CAMERA AUTO.
Conditions Requiring Manual Focus
When recording a subject through a
window.
When recording a subject having a
close foreground and a background
that is far away.
When recording in low-light situa-
tions.
When recording two subjects at
different distances that overlap in the
same scene.
When the subject is not in the center
of the scene.
When recording a scene with fast
motions, like a tennis swing.
